summaryrefslogtreecommitdiffstats
path: root/ldap/servers/slapd/control.c
diff options
context:
space:
mode:
authorPete Rowley <prowley@redhat.com>2006-01-10 19:30:12 +0000
committerPete Rowley <prowley@redhat.com>2006-01-10 19:30:12 +0000
commit4120eda907e600d7d4b7c3b54e747db8284b4037 (patch)
treee119b7dad4b8b024c7d938b4fe9214f2ff937fa6 /ldap/servers/slapd/control.c
parentddbfc31998f37401fc3c5998c6b8a2001f06c5bc (diff)
downloadds-4120eda907e600d7d4b7c3b54e747db8284b4037.tar.gz
ds-4120eda907e600d7d4b7c3b54e747db8284b4037.tar.xz
ds-4120eda907e600d7d4b7c3b54e747db8284b4037.zip
177444: duplicate password policy oids in root DSE
Diffstat (limited to 'ldap/servers/slapd/control.c')
-rw-r--r--ldap/servers/slapd/control.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/ldap/servers/slapd/control.c b/ldap/servers/slapd/control.c
index d9cce7d7..40a72979 100644
--- a/ldap/servers/slapd/control.c
+++ b/ldap/servers/slapd/control.c
@@ -95,10 +95,16 @@ init_controls( void )
SLAPI_OPERATION_SEARCH | SLAPI_OPERATION_COMPARE
| SLAPI_OPERATION_ADD | SLAPI_OPERATION_DELETE
| SLAPI_OPERATION_MODIFY | SLAPI_OPERATION_MODDN );
+/*
+ We do not register the password policy response because it has
+ the same oid as the request (and it was being reported twice in
+ in the root DSE supportedControls attribute)
+
slapi_register_supported_control( LDAP_X_CONTROL_PWPOLICY_RESPONSE,
SLAPI_OPERATION_SEARCH | SLAPI_OPERATION_COMPARE
| SLAPI_OPERATION_ADD | SLAPI_OPERATION_DELETE
| SLAPI_OPERATION_MODIFY | SLAPI_OPERATION_MODDN );
+*/
slapi_register_supported_control( LDAP_CONTROL_GET_EFFECTIVE_RIGHTS,
SLAPI_OPERATION_SEARCH );
}